Step-by-Step Form Guide
- Hand Position: Place hands close together under chest, forming triangle or diamond shape with thumbs and fingers
- Body Alignment: Maintain straight line from head to heels, engaging core throughout movement
- Descent Phase: Lower body until chest nearly touches hands, keeping elbows close to torso
- Push Phase: Drive through palms to return to start, maintaining rigid body position
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Placing hands too close together causing wrist strain
- Flaring elbows out wide instead of keeping them tucked
- Sagging hips or arching back
- Partial range of motion
- Not engaging core for stability
